Как получить доступ к переменной, объявленной в скрипте setup, из скрипта?

Как обратиться к глобальной переменной, объявленной в секции "script setup" из метода, который определен в секции "methods" объекта компонента во Vue.js? Переменные, объявленные через "defineProps", не могут быть использованы для этой цели.
  • 4 марта 2024 г. 7:28
Ответы на вопрос 1
Для доступа к переменной, объявленной в скрипте setup из скрипта, можно воспользоваться реактивными переменными Vue, такими как ref или reactive. 

Например, если у вас есть переменная, объявленная в секции setup:

```js
<script setup>
  const myVar = ref('Hello World');
</script>
```

Вы можете обратиться к этой переменной в методе компонента, определенном в секции methods:

```js
<script>
export default {
  methods: {
    accessMyVar() {
      console.log(myVar.value); // Выведет 'Hello World'
    }
  }
}
</script>
```

Таким образом, используя ref, вы можете получить доступ к переменной, объявленной в секции setup, из метода объекта компонента в Vue.js.
Похожие вопросы